1. Centennial Olympic Park

Your journey begins at Centennial Olympic Park, a sprawling greenspace built for the 1996 Olympic Games. Here, you can marvel at the Fountain of Rings, a beautiful interactive fountain, and the Quilt Plazas, which commemorate the Olympic spirit and honor the victims of the Centennial Olympic Park bombing. 2. The World of Coca-Cola

Next, it’s time to discover the history and culture behind everyone’s favorite fizzy beverage at The World of Coca-Cola. Learn about the origins of Coca-Cola, explore a variety of exhibits, and taste different flavors from around the world. Don’t forget to snap a selfie with the iconic Coca-Cola polar bear!

3. Georgia Aquarium

Prepare to be amazed by the wonders of the deep at the Georgia Aquarium, one of the largest aquariums in the world. Explore a diverse array of aquatic life, including beluga whales, sea turtles, and vibrant coral reefs. The aquarium offers an unforgettable experience for both children and adults.

4. National Center for Civil and Human Rights

Dive into the history of the American civil rights movement at the National Center for Civil and Human Rights. Through interactive exhibits and powerful storytelling, gain a deeper understanding of the struggle for equality and the individuals who fought to make a difference.
